Game development isn't hard to do. What is hard to do is to create a team that works well enough together to see a project to completion. Make sure you work well with your development team, remember to have a good time. If you don't get along well, the game will suffer from it.
Do not be afraid to work and do not whine when you've got too much work to do. Do not forget that there are many available job positions for, say, graphic designers / 2D artists / programmers, but there is usually only one for the composer. So if you have any kind of work as a composer – stick to it, always try giving 110% out of you and it will be paid off sooner or later!

The SoundWorks Collection talks with Composer Yoav Goren in his Santa Monica studio to explore the exciting and creative process of epic trailer music composing and producing.
Mass Effect 3: Citadel offers players one last chance to embark on an adventure with the characters and companions they have come to love throughout the Mass Effect trilogy. Sam Hulick, Cris Velasco, and Sascha Dikiciyan came together to compose an emotional and powerful score for this personal journey.
